Biography

Lajos Kutasi, as a handball player of Elektromos, won the Hungarian championship in 1935 and 1937. Between 1935 and 1938 he appeared in the Hungarian national team 12 times. He was a member of national team at the 1936 Olympic Games, finishing fourth and at the 1938 World Championship also in Berlin, winning the bronze medal. After completing his career, he remained close to the sport as a referee. He worked as an electrical engineer at the Budapest Electric Works.
